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the crack and the underlying damage can significantly impact the cost of repairs.
- Slab Size: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all expense.
- Soil Conditions: Park City's specific soil type can affect the complexity and cost of the repair process.
- Accessibility: Easy access to the damaged area can reduce labor costs, while difficult access can increase them.
- Materials Used: The choice of materials, such as concrete quality and reinforcement type, will influence the cost.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Park City, UT, can vary, affecting the total cost of the project.
- Permits and Inspections: Obtaining necessary permits and passing inspections can add to the overall c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Minor Crack Repair | $500 - $1,000 |
Moderate Crack Repair |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Major Crack Replacement | $2,500 - $5,000 |
Full Slab Replacement |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Soil Stabilization |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$500 |
